Taxonomic Classification

Rank Bleeding Blue Tooth Indisches Riesenhörnchen
Kingdom Fungi (Pilze) Animalia (Tier)
Phylum Basidiomycota (Ständerpilze) Chordata (Chordatiere)
Class Agaricomycetes (Mushrooms) Mammalia (Säugetiere)
Order Thelephorales (Thelephorales) Rodentia (Nagetiere)
Family Bankeraceae Sciuridae (Squirrels)
Genus Hydnellum Ratufa
Species Hydnellum cyanopodium Ratufa indica
